Resume Job Match Lab
Purpose
Tailor resumes and project bullets to a target role, quantify gaps, and prepare an interview-ready evidence map.
Trigger phrases
- - 简历匹配岗位
- tailor my resume
- ATS 优化
- job match analysis
- 面试证据图
Ask for these inputs
- - resume text
- job description
- target seniority
- region/industry
- portfolio or projects if any
Workflow
- 1. Extract must-have and nice-to-have requirements from the job description.
- Score resume coverage against the keyword template.
- Rewrite bullets to emphasize outcome, scope, and tools without fabricating claims.
- Generate a gap analysis and interview evidence map.
- Return both a conservative ATS version and a human-friendly version.
Output contract
- - match scorecard
- rewritten bullets
- gap analysis
- interview evidence map
Files in this skill
- - Script: INLINECODE0
- Resource: INLINECODE1
Operating rules
- - Be concrete and action-oriented.
- Prefer preview / draft / simulation mode before destructive changes.
- If information is missing, ask only for the minimum needed to proceed.
- Never fabricate metrics, legal certainty, receipts, credentials, or evidence.
- Keep assumptions explicit.
Suggested prompts
- - 简历匹配岗位
- tailor my resume
- ATS 优化
Use of script and resources
Use the bundled script when it helps the user produce a structured file, manifest, CSV, or first-pass draft.
Use the resource file as the default schema, checklist, or preset when the user does not provide one.
Boundaries
- - This skill supports planning, structuring, and first-pass artifacts.
- It should not claim that files were modified, messages were sent, or legal/financial decisions were finalized unless the user actually performed those actions.
Compatibility notes
- - Directory-based AgentSkills/OpenClaw skill.
- Runtime dependency declared through
metadata.openclaw.requires. - Helper script is local and auditable:
scripts/resume_match.py. - Bundled resource is local and referenced by the instructions:
resources/ats_keywords_template.csv.
简历岗位匹配实验室
目的
针对目标岗位定制简历和项目要点,量化差距,并准备面试证据图。
触发短语
- - 简历匹配岗位
- tailor my resume
- ATS 优化
- job match analysis
- 面试证据图
需要提供的输入
- - 简历文本
- 职位描述
- 目标职级
- 地区/行业
- 作品集或项目(如有)
工作流程
- 1. 从职位描述中提取必备要求和加分项。
- 根据关键词模板对简历覆盖率进行评分。
- 重写要点,突出成果、范围和工具使用,不虚构任何内容。
- 生成差距分析和面试证据图。
- 同时返回保守版ATS版本和人性化版本。
输出约定
本技能包含的文件
- - 脚本:{baseDir}/scripts/resumematch.py
- 资源:{baseDir}/resources/atskeywords_template.csv
操作规则
- - 具体且以行动为导向。
- 在破坏性更改前优先使用预览/草稿/模拟模式。
- 如果信息缺失,仅询问继续所需的最少信息。
- 绝不虚构指标、法律确定性、收据、资质或证据。
- 保持假设明确。
建议提示语
- - 简历匹配岗位
- tailor my resume
- ATS 优化
脚本和资源的使用
当脚本有助于用户生成结构化文件、清单、CSV或初稿时,使用捆绑脚本。
当用户未提供资源文件时,将其用作默认模式、检查清单或预设。
边界
- - 本技能支持规划、结构化和初稿产出。
- 除非用户实际执行了相关操作,否则不应声称文件已被修改、消息已发送或法律/财务决策已完成。
兼容性说明
- - 基于目录的AgentSkills/OpenClaw技能。
- 通过metadata.openclaw.requires声明运行时依赖。
- 辅助脚本为本地可审计文件:scripts/resumematch.py。
- 捆绑资源为本地文件,由指令引用:resources/atskeywords_template.csv。